hello all,
Iam working on a small hobby robotic arm.
where aim using 3 steppers and 2 small dc gear motors.
in these DC motors,one for rotation and other for closing the gripper.as i don't need much accuracy,i will run these DC motors based on time(using g04).
so how do we do it using mach3.i can assign 2 outputs for each motors,to interchange the polarities for CW and CCW motion.
so to enable these outputs,do i need to work on macros.
over all i need to control 4 outputs using M-Codes.
